diff --git a/src/main/java/me/ayunami2000/ayunViaProxyEagUtils/Main.java b/src/main/java/me/ayunami2000/ayunViaProxyEagUtils/Main.java index 902000c..129e3c2 100644 --- a/src/main/java/me/ayunami2000/ayunViaProxyEagUtils/Main.java +++ b/src/main/java/me/ayunami2000/ayunViaProxyEagUtils/Main.java @@ -99,7 +99,7 @@ public class Main extends ViaProxyPlugin { c2p.attr(secureWs).set(true); } - if (c2p.hasAttr(secureWs)) { + if (c2p.hasAttr(secureWs) && c2p.attr(secureWs).get() != null) { doWsServerStuff(ch, proxyConnection, c2p, addr); if (!event.isLegacyPassthrough()) { ch.pipeline().addFirst("handshake-waiter", new ChannelOutboundHandlerAdapter() {